How Glass Benefits The Organic Agriculture Industry

Growth in pesticide use across all agriculture crops has created concern about the potential effects of pesticides on food safety, air and groundwater quality, worker safety, and wildlife mortality. In the United States, many pesticides have been removed from the market due to stricter environmental and public health regulations. For example, methyl iodide was regulated in California as a replacement for MB in 2010, and was quickly withdrawn in 2012 due to worker and public health impacts. Similarly, in 2015, a series of regulatory actions at both the federal and state levels curtailed the use of several fumigants. The use of toxic pesticides is expected to be further limited as we learn more about the effects on plants, mammals, and our soil.

The Science Behind Silicon in SiONEER

Silicon is an available nutrient for all plants grown in soil. It interacts with other plant nutrients such as nitrogen, phosphorous, and potassium, and influences their uptake. Silicon can lead to increased uptake by directly absorbing nutrients and therefor making them more available to the plant. Silicon can also increase climate stress resistance, improve drought resistance, increase soil fertility, and provide a number of other benefits including protection by reducing insects, pests, frost damage, and countering the negative effects of excess sodium in the soil.

Amorphous silicon dioxide (SiO2), active in all SiONEER products, has additionally shown contributions to increased plant health, fertility, and resistance to stresses such as drought and pathogens.

Research has also indicated that silicon increases plant resistance to pathogens such as fungi, bacteria, and insects. Silicon is deposited in to the plant cell walls as solid amorphous silica – providing structural rigidity and strength to the plant. This strengthens the outer epidermis, allowing it to defend against pests and provide greater resistance against disease and pathogens, such as fungi or mildew.

How Does SiO2 Work On Insects?

Amorphous silica, an absorptive dust, has the ability to cling to or be absorbed by the waxy layer on the outside of most insects. This outer layer is called the epicuticle and acts as a protective barrier to excessive loss of water from the body. When SiONEER dust is applied to a plant or soil, and comes in contact with an insect, the dust is absorbed by that protective outer layer. As the epicuticle is ruptured by the dust, the insect is eradicated by desiccation.
